# jsx-a11y/prefer-tag-over-role Enforces using semantic DOM elements over the ARIA `role` property. ## Rule details This rule takes no arguments. ### Succeed ```jsx
...
...
``` ### Fail ```jsx
``` ## Accessibility guidelines - [WAI-ARIA Roles model](https://www.w3.org/TR/wai-aria-1.0/roles) ### Resources - [MDN WAI-ARIA Roles](https://developer.mozilla.org/en-US/docs/Web/Accessibility/ARIA/Roles)